How much do sales director j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 6, 2026, the average yearly pay for sales director in Decatur, GA is $101,524.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$68,800.00 and $122,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Sales Director vs Sales Manager?

AspectSales DirectorSales Manager
ResponsibilitiesOversees sales strategies, sets long-term goals, manages senior sales teamsManages daily sales operations, supervises sales staff, executes sales plans
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, often MBA, extensive sales experience, leadership skillsBachelor's degree, sales experience, team management skills
Work EnvironmentExecutive-level meetings, strategic planning, high-level client interactionsTeam supervision, client meetings, sales reporting
Industry UsageCommon in large organizations, corporate sales divisionsFound across various industries, smaller to mid-sized companies

The main difference between a Sales Director and a Sales Manager lies in their scope and strategic focus. Sales Directors focus on long-term sales strategies and leadership at an executive level, while Sales Managers handle daily operations and team management. Both roles require sales experience and leadership skills, but the Sales Director's role is more strategic and high-level.

Is a sales director a high position?

A sales director is a senior leadership role responsible for overseeing a company's sales strategies and teams. It is generally considered a high-level position within an organization, often reporting to executives like the vice president or chief sales officer. The role typically requires extensive experience, leadership skills, and a strong understanding of sales processes and market dynamics.
